Xojo 语言 常量定义与命名规范

Xojo阿木 发布于 19 天前 5 次阅读


阿木博主一句话概括:Xojo【1】 语言常量【2】定义与命名规范【3】详解

阿木博主为你简单介绍:
在软件开发过程中,常量作为一种重要的数据类型,用于存储在程序运行过程中不会改变的值。Xojo 语言作为一种跨平台的编程语言,其常量的定义与命名规范对于代码的可读性【4】、可维护性【5】和一致性至关重要。本文将围绕 Xojo 语言常量的定义与命名规范展开,详细探讨其最佳实践【6】

一、
常量在编程中扮演着重要的角色,它们可以用来表示程序中固定的值,如配置参数、系统参数等。在 Xojo 语言中,常量的定义与命名规范有助于提高代码的质量和团队协作效率。本文将详细介绍 Xojo 语言常量的定义方法、命名规范以及相关最佳实践。

二、Xojo 语言常量的定义
在 Xojo 语言中,常量的定义通常使用 `Const` 关键字。以下是一个简单的常量定义示例:

xojo
Const MAX_USERS As Integer = 100
Const API_KEY As String = "1234567890abcdef"

在这个例子中,我们定义了两个常量:`MAX_USERS` 和 `API_KEY`。`MAX_USERS` 是一个整型常量,表示最大用户数;`API_KEY` 是一个字符串常量,表示 API 密钥【7】

三、Xojo 语言常量的命名规范
1. 驼峰命名法【8】(CamelCase)
在 Xojo 语言中,常量的命名通常采用驼峰命名法。这意味着每个单词的首字母大写,除了第一个单词。以下是一些常量命名的示例:

xojo
Const MAX_USERS As Integer = 100
Const API_KEY As String = "1234567890abcdef"
Const DEFAULT_PORT As Integer = 8080

2. 常量命名前缀【9】
为了提高代码的可读性和一致性,建议在常量命名时添加前缀。以下是一些常用的前缀:

- `k` 或 `K`:表示常量(如 `kMaxUsers`)
- `g` 或 `G`:表示全局常量(如 `gAPIKey`)
- `c` 或 `C`:表示配置常量(如 `cDefaultPort`)

3. 避免使用缩写
在常量命名中,尽量避免使用缩写,除非缩写是广泛认可的。这是因为缩写可能会降低代码的可读性,并增加出错的可能性。

四、Xojo 语言常量的最佳实践
1. 使用常量来表示可配置的值
将可配置的值定义为常量,有助于在程序中集中管理这些值,并在需要修改时方便地进行更新。

2. 保持常量命名的一致性
在项目中,保持常量命名的一致性对于代码的可维护性至关重要。确保所有常量都遵循相同的命名规范。

3. 使用常量注释
为常量添加注释,解释其用途和值,有助于其他开发者理解代码。

4. 避免使用硬编码【10】的常量
在可能的情况下,避免在代码中直接使用硬编码的常量值。使用常量可以减少错误,并提高代码的可维护性。

五、总结
Xojo 语言常量的定义与命名规范是软件开发中不可或缺的一部分。遵循良好的常量定义和命名规范,可以提高代码的可读性、可维护性和一致性。本文详细介绍了 Xojo 语言常量的定义方法、命名规范以及相关最佳实践,希望对开发者有所帮助。

(注:由于篇幅限制,本文未能达到3000字,但已尽量详尽地阐述了 Xojo 语言常量的相关内容。)